免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app产品介绍与开发

移动互联网时代的到来,让人们更加便捷地获取信息和进行各种活动。而在移动互联网中,app起着至关重要的作用,它成为了人们获取信息、进行消费、娱乐、交流的重要工具之一。那么,什么是app,它的特点又是什么呢?

一、什么是app

App是英文Application的缩写,它可以翻译为“应用程序”,指运行在智能手机、平板电脑等移动终端设备上、可提供各种服务的应用程序。它已经成为移动互联网时代的标志性产物,常常被人们称为移动应用。

二、app的特点

1.快捷高效

与传统的电脑软件相比,应用程序不仅启动速度快,而且具有响应速度快,节省时间、方便使用的优点。

2.个性化定制

App以用户为中心,可针对具体需求进行个性化定制,用户只需下载安装即可享受所需的服务。

3.在线互动

App通常具有社交性和互动性,用户可通过App进行各种社交活动,如微博、微信、QQ等,与用户进行互动,进行分享、评论、点赞等。

4.商业化营销

对于企业而言,通过App的开发可以直接面向用户,推广企业品牌,促销产品,增加销售额,提高盈利。

三、app的开发

App开发主要分为前端开发和后端开发,前端开发常用的开发语言是Java、Kotlin、Object-C、Swift等;后端开发则以PHP、Node.js、Java,Python等语言为主。

1.前端开发

前端开发既是创建用户界面的过程,也是实现app功能的过程。前端开发主要分为设计和编码两个阶段。

(1)设计:在设计思路和用户体验方面,开发团队需要考虑如何实现功能、页面布局、色彩搭配、图标等设计要素。

(2)编码:前端开发人员需要运用专业的开发软件进行编码,如Android Studio、Xcode等。

2.后端开发

后端开发负责服务器端的接口开发和数据库建立等工作,主要包括编写动态语言(如PHP,Node.js)或框架开发(如Java或Python)等技术。

(1)动态语言:通常用于开发Web应用服务器端的程序,如PHP、Python等语言。

(2)框架开发:区别于动态语言,框架是一种设计模式,它将数据的实现细节等独立出来,减少程序出错风险,程序的安全性和性能更优,如Java的Spring框架。

总之,App开发需要做到两个核心点:一个是用户体验,另一个则是实现功能。只有同时做到这两点,才能让用户拥有良好的使用体验,从而提高用户的满意度。

文章结尾:上述就是介绍App产品与开发的相关知识,App作为移动互联网时代的重要应用程序,已经成为人们的生活不可缺少的一部分,而对于开发团队来说,在开发过程中,应注意严格按照设计要求推进项目,通过不断地掌握前端、后端等开发技能,探索不断进行优化和改进,为用户提供更加优质的服务。


相关知识:
app社区平台开发价格
App社区平台是指可以让用户在移动设备上互动、交流的平台,类似于微博、微信朋友圈等社交媒体应用。开发一个App社区平台需要考虑多个方面,包括功能设计、技术开发、用户体验等。功能设计是App社区平台开发的重要一环。一个成功的社区平台应该有以下功能:1. 用户
2023-07-14
app手机平台开发
app手机平台开发是近年来迅速发展的领域,它提供了一个全新的方式来为用户提供各种功能和服务。在本文中,我将详细介绍app手机平台开发的原理和步骤。首先,让我们来了解一下什么是app。app是指应用程序,是一种基于手机操作系统的应用软件。它能够直接在手机上运
2023-07-14
app外包订制开发案例
App外包订制开发是指将App的开发工作外包给专业的开发团队或个人进行开发和定制。这种方式可以帮助企业节省开发成本、缩短开发周期,并且可以获得专业的技术支持和服务。在进行App外包订制开发时,首先需要明确自己的需求和目标。你要考虑的问题包括:你想开发的Ap
2023-07-14
app开发者查询平台官网
APP开发者查询平台是一个为APP开发者提供方便快捷的查询服务的网站。通过该平台,开发者可以轻松地获取关于各种技术问题、API文档、代码示例等相关信息,提高开发效率和解决问题的能力。该平台的官网主要包含以下几个部分:首页、技术文档、API查询、代码示例、社
2023-06-29
app开发模型介绍
在移动应用领域,开发者通常会采用不同的开发模型,以便更好地应对不同的应用需求和开发挑战。下面将详细介绍几种常见的移动应用开发模型。一、瀑布模型瀑布模型是最早也是最常用的应用开发模型之一。在这种模型中,应用的开发流程被划分为多个连续阶段,如需求分析、系统设计
2023-06-29
app定制开发客户注意事项
在如今的移动互联网时代,各个行业都需要有自己的移动应用来满足用户的需求与便利使用。有时候,行业特有的需求需要定制化开发操作系统才能够满足。针对此,很多公司和机构选择了App的定制开发。在这个过程中,客户需要注意以下事项:1. 澄清需求在定制开发之前,客户需
2023-05-06